Robert Lewandowski has dropped a transfer hint over his future after the 33-year-old forward has confirmed his intention to not sign a contract extension with Bayern Munich.
Speaking to Sky Germany whilst at the Monaco
Grand Prix on Sunday, Lewandowski replied to
questions over his future by stating that "The time
will come to give information.
Soon it will be possible to say more." Lewandowski is expected to sign for Barcelona should he leave Bayern this window with the La Liga giants favourite for his signature.

However,
Chelsea have been linked with Lewandowski in
recent weeks, with hopes of securing the forward
should the chance arise.
As reported by The Guardian , Chelsea could join the race to sign Lewandowski despite the Bayern Munich forward favouring a move to Barcelona.

It is claimed Thomas Tuchel is a huge admirer of
Lewandowski, who has scored 343 goals since
joining Bayern in 2014, and would have loved to
bring him to Chelsea last summer.
Chelsea have been linked to another Bundesliga forward in RB Leipzig's Christopher Nkunku , who is also rumoured to be leaving Germany this summer.
